Tech Inferno Fan Posted May 25, 2015 Author Share Posted May 25, 2015 I'm quite sure that is fine but I thought I might ask anyway. Thinking of buying a 2m thunderbolt cable. The original ones (TB1) are much cheaper. Since I have 2012 TB1 macbook is it ok to buy the old TB1 cable version ?TB1 and TB2 both transmit up to 10Gbps per channel. Only difference with TB2 is it allows aggregation of the two channels to provide 20Gbps: Thunderbolt (interface) -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ia . Based on that info any Thunderbolt cable will work fine. The wiki even says the maximum copper cable length is 3M. Optical cable can have lengths up to 60m. Pretty much all Macbooks look alike so have no idea if you are using a 2011 or 2015 TB Macbook.I'll mention that the black screen issue is something that does occur if using MBR/BIOS mode. Using GPT/UEFI mode along with Win8.1 resolved this issue when I tested it: http://forum.techinferno.com/implementation-guides-apple/3062-2012-13-macbook-pro-gtx660ti-hd7870%408gbps-tb1-th05-win7-%5BTech Inferno Fan%5D.html#post42483 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
